United Go Back To Moscow
Manchester United have fond memories of the Luzhniki Stadium in Moscow where they play CSKA tonight. It was here they clinched the 2008 Champions League Final against Chelsea by virtue of John Terry’s penalty miss.
United will be without Rooney, Giggs, Fletcher and Evra, while Berbatov and Vidic are booth doubtful. Best odds on the match at present are 6/5 Man United with Blue Square and Bet 365, CSKA are 11/4 shots with Paddy Power and the draw 23/10 with Coral and William Hill.
